windows系统自动定时备份mysql数据库

背景:数据库备份相当重要,尤其是在系统升级或者数据库迁移的时候。


脚本:

@echo 开始备份数据库  
cd\
d:
set "Ymd=%date:~,4%%date:~5,2%%date:~8,2%"  
cd softwareInstallationAddress\AppServ\MySQL\bin\
mysqldump --opt -u root --password=123456 dev > D:\db_backup\dev_%Ymd%.sql
@echo 完成备份数据库 
pause

获取系统时间:

set "Ymd=%date:~,4%%date:~5,2%%date:~8,2%"  

找到备份指令

cd softwareInstallationAddress\AppServ\MySQL\bin\

备份系统盘

mysqldump --opt -u root --password=123456 dev > D:\db_backup\dev_%Ymd%.sql

备份远程数据库

mysqldump --opt -h 127.0.0.7 -P 3306 -u root --password=root dev > D:\db_backup\dev_%Ymd%.sql



發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章